Application of a method for student academic performance control
Petersburg State Transport University, 9 Moskovsky pr, 190031, Saint Petersburg, Russian Federation
* Corresponding author: r.s.kudarov@gmail.com
A method for monitoring the results of academic performance of students in a mathematical discipline is considered. As part of the monitoring method, a mathematics testing system was developed, implemented on the basis of the Moodle distance learning system platform. A bank of questions was compiled, including more than 600 tasks in elementary Mathematics and more than 900 tasks in Further Mathematics, on the basis of which tests were created to check the progress of students. To analyze the results of intermediate testing in mathematics, the rank correlation coefficients of Spearman and Kendall were calculated. A comparison of the results of tests conducted in the classroom and remotely.
